TehRaydarlover Posted March 5, 2017 Author Report Share Posted March 5, 2017 Well I took it for a drive yesterday and right away it was misfiring really bad under load. I drove straight to kwik trip to get some fresh gas, talking with the PO the gas was probably well over a year old. Fresh gas helped a lot but it went into limp mode and still misses under load. I'm pretty sure I fouled the plugs, but any other ideas? I ran the codes and it had the same ones as before I started working on it. Secondary air pump, coolant temp, and bank one over retarded. Coolant temp I'm sure was just the sensor, and over retarded was the lack of timing chain guide. I'm thinking plugs because just cruzing it's fine only under load is it missing, but maybe it's the injectors?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

B C Posted March 5, 2017 Report Share Posted March 5, 2017 Could this be vanos sensor/cam sensor related? Cam timing NOT changing under load and not jiving with the fuel and timing maps is the first thing that comes to my mind. Does it happen while revving in neutral?
